Stone-clad and splendid, the main house here dates back to the 16th century. It’s an old farmhouse which once housed the olive press for the surrounding groves and you can feel this history in each terracotta-floored room inside. There’s something soothing about the timber beams of the low ceiling in the living room and the hearth-like fireplace is a nod to the old world. An open archway opens up to the dining room and there’s a second sitting room with cute, wooden-shuttered windows. Another stone archway reveals a full-sized snooker table for sociable evenings indoors and the dine-in kitchen is perfect for big, bustling family breakfasts dappled in sunshine. But it’s the outdoors that really grabbed our attention. 175 acres of land is home to olive groves, a babbling river and orange groves. You can even enjoy a stroll through the evergreen oak woodlands without leaving the privacy of the grounds. The free-form swimming pool is like a huge lagoon on the terrace and we love the stone dining table beneath the twisting vines. Balconies and patios provide places to look out over the grounds, like a monarch surveying your kingdom, and Mallorca’s picturesque mountains flank you on all sides. Location-wise, you’re secluded in the countryside, but the honey-hued traditional town of Pollensa is just six kilometres away for restaurants, shops, bars and cafes.

Home truths

    There is a full maid service and cook provided with a stay at this villa

    This home is split over two levels and the gardens are terraced so it may not be suitable for those with limited mobility

    The closest town is 6km away, so having a car is recommended and there is plenty of private parking

    The swimming pool isn't fenced, so children will need to be supervised at all times

    Though there isn't a dedicated desk here, the dining table doubles up as a laptop-friendly workspace

    You'll have your own private entrance here

About Pollença

Coloured in ancient history that dates back to the Romans, staying in Pollença is truly a cultural experience. While it still retains much of its medieval charm, its history is also linked to painting as the town attracted many artists due to the irresistible and glorious light that falls upon the blonde buildings.
